Filed 2/24/11 CERTIFIED FOR PUBLICATION IN THE COURT OF APPEAL OF THE STATE OF CALIFORNIA SECOND APPELLATE DISTRICT DIVISION ONE In re the Marriage of B214824 SANDRA and EDWARD FOSSUM. __________________________________ (Los Angeles County Super. Ct. No. BD382683) SANDRA FOSSUM, Respondent, v. ORDER MODIFYING OPINION (Scott M. Gordon, Judge) [NO CHANGE IN JUDGMENT] EDWARD FOSSUM. Appellant. . THE COURT: IT IS ORDERED that the Concurring and Dissenting opinion by Justice Rothschild, as Acting Presiding Justice, filed on January 28, 2011, be modified in the following particulars: 1. On page 2, last sentence of the first paragraph, delete the text and irrespective of need and ability to pay between the words issue and is so that the sentence now reads: A mandatory award of attorney fees, imposed regardless of the value of the asset at issue, is a harsh remedy for a violation that is merely In re Marriage of Fossum B214824 2 technical and wholly innocent, as might often be the case, so it is unlikely the Legislature intended such a result. 2. On page 2, add a footnote 2 at the end of the last sentence of the first paragraph, ending with result and add the following text to the footnote: 2 I note, however, that before imposing a mandatory attorney fees award under subdivision (g) of section 1101, the trial court must determine that the party has or is reasonably likely to have the ability to pay. (ยง 270.) This modification does not constitute a change in the judgment. ___________________________________________________________________ ROTHSCHILD, Acting P. J.
